We have an exciting new opportunity for a Capability Manager - Mechanical. As the Capability Manager, you will be responsible for mechanical design delivery and line management for a team of Mechanical Engineers. As part of NautIQ Solutions team, you will be working closely with other engineering disciplines to design Low Voltage Power Distribution Systems and Equipment for Naval applications.

NautIQ Solutions UK is located in Bristol and Heybridge and is a part of Rolls-Royce Power Systems that focuses on delivering electrical and automation products to our Naval and Commercial Marine customers. We have a wide base of global customers, predominantly naval, to whom we currently supply Low Voltage Distribution Systems and Automation products.

We're at the forefront of innovation and experience in the marine sector from standalone products to complex integrated systems. A leading provider of propulsion, handling and distribution solutions for naval markets, we have more than 4,000 customers, with 70 naval forces and over 30,000 commercial vessels using our equipment.
